While Paramount has released some burn-on-demand titles recently [Atlantic City; On a Clear Day, You Can See Forever; The Two Jakes], this is part of a special release series [Paramount Presents] and highly unlikely to be a burned disc.Unlike Amazon's slowness in sending newly released Warner Archive blu rays, Roman Holiday is out for delivery from Amazon today on release day!
I hope Paramount isn't one of those companies that allows Amazon to distribute Amazon-burned discs rather than officially pressed ones.
